Exciting Opportunity: Religious Studies (RS) & PSHE Teacher at Bitterne Park School
Are you passionate about nurturing students' understanding of beliefs, ethics, and personal, social and health education? Bitterne Park School is seeking a committed and inspiring Religious Studies and PSHE Teacher to join our dedicated team and contribute to holistic student development.
In this role, you will deliver engaging lessons that explore a range of religious traditions alongside vital PSHE topics such as mental health, relationships, citizenship, and wellbeing, supporting students in becoming informed, responsible, and empathetic citizens.
Key Responsibilities
- Plan, develop, and deliver dynamic RS and PSHE lessons aligned with the national curriculum and school ethos.
- Create a safe and inclusive classroom environment that promotes open discussion and critical thinking.
- Assess and monitor student progress in RS and PSHE, providing constructive feedback and support.
- Integrate contemporary issues and real-life applications to make learning relevant and impactful.
- Collaborate with colleagues to enhance the PSHE program and contribute to school-wide initiatives.
